Olá povo, gostaria de saber se é possível exibir um único item de uma lista, sem usar Datatable ou algo do tipo.
Por exemplo:
<h:outputText value="#{bean.lista[0].nome}"/>
Vlw.
Olá povo, gostaria de saber se é possível exibir um único item de uma lista, sem usar Datatable ou algo do tipo.
Por exemplo:
<h:outputText value="#{bean.lista[0].nome}"/>
Vlw.
[quote=six_machine]Olá povo, gostaria de saber se é possível exibir um único item de uma lista, sem usar Datatable ou algo do tipo.
Por exemplo:
<h:outputText value="#{bean.lista[0].nome}"/>
Vlw.[/quote]É mais fácil você criar um método em seu MB que faça isso para você:
public String getPrimeiroNomeDaLista(){
return lista[0].getNome();
}
six_machine, se a sua lista for do tipo List, use a sintaxe:
lista.get(0).getName()
Como percebi que você quer fazer a chamada em um componente JSF use a sintaxe
#{seuBean.lista.get(0).name}
Se sua lista for um Array, aí faça na sintaxe que o jakefrog lhe passou mesmo
Att.
[quote=jakefrog][quote=six_machine]Olá povo, gostaria de saber se é possível exibir um único item de uma lista, sem usar Datatable ou algo do tipo.
Por exemplo:
<h:outputText value="#{bean.lista[0].nome}"/>
Vlw.[/quote]É mais fácil você criar um método em seu MB que faça isso para você:
public String getPrimeiroNomeDaLista(){
return lista[0].getNome();
}
[/quote]
Ok, acho que isso me esclareu bastante coisa.
Vlw